Codictionary features and specs

  • Centralized Code Knowledge
    Codictionary provides a centralized platform for storing and organizing coding terminology, definitions, and snippets, making it easier for developers to find and reference information in one place.
  • Collaborative Learning
    The platform supports collaborative contributions, allowing developers to share knowledge, add definitions, and help build a community-driven coding dictionary that benefits everyone.
  • Beginner-Friendly
    Codictionary is designed to be accessible to newcomers in programming, offering clear and simple explanations of coding terms and concepts that can help beginners get up to speed quickly.
  • Free to Use
    The platform is available for free, making it an accessible resource for developers at all levels without requiring a subscription or payment to access coding definitions and knowledge.
  • Clean and Simple Interface
    Codictionary features a straightforward and easy-to-navigate user interface, allowing users to quickly search for and find the coding terms and definitions they need without unnecessary complexity.

Possible disadvantages of Codictionary

  • Limited Content Depth
    As a relatively niche platform, Codictionary may not have the breadth or depth of content found on more established resources like Stack Overflow, MDN, or official documentation sites.
  • Small Community
    The platform has a smaller user base compared to major developer communities, which means fewer contributions, slower updates, and potentially less peer review of content accuracy.
  • Limited Advanced Topics
    The platform may focus more on basic definitions and terminology, potentially lacking in-depth coverage of advanced programming concepts, design patterns, or complex technical topics.
  • Potential for Outdated Information
    With a smaller community maintaining content, some entries may become outdated as programming languages and technologies evolve, without timely updates to reflect current best practices.
  • Less Recognized Platform
    Being a lesser-known tool in the developer ecosystem, Codictionary may not be widely recognized or trusted as an authoritative source compared to well-established documentation and reference sites.
